We are selling these scores on a licensing system, based on one used for many years by our colleagues, Fretwork Publishing (for which we are very grateful!) We ask the purchaser to state the purpose for which the music is required, in order to determine a fair price and to protect of copyright. If a single copy is required for personal use, we ask the purchaser to sign an agreement licensing the printing of a single copy of the file with an undertaking not to pass the file on to others. If multiple copies will be required, we calculate a figure which is a multiple of the same unit price but discounted according to quantity, and the license agreement states the agreed number of copies that may be printed.
This has proved to be a useful and economic way for choirs to purchase repertoire (and of course, there is also no postage to pay on digital publications). The system obviously depends on good faith, but has proved a successful way of highlighting and protecting copyright, which is at greater risk in digital publishing.
We are also asking that, if you record or perform these works in a public place that has a license from your location’s relevant performing rights organisation, you make sure the venue or the promoter notifies them properly. There is no additional cost to performers for this!!
